Pre Matric Scholarship for ST Students (Class 9 & 10), Goa 2021-22 is an initiative for ST students of Class 9 and 10. The scholarship is applicable for candidates who are domiciles of Goa.
Pre Matric Scholarship for ST Students (Class 9 & 10), Goa 2021-22
DeadlineClosed Eligibility To be eligible for this scholarship, an applicant must-
- Be a domicile of Goa
- Be a regular, full-time student studying in Class 9 or 10
- Belong to Scheduled Tribes community
- Have an annual family income of less than INR 2 lakh
- Not be getting any other centrally-funded Pre-Matric Scholarship
- Be enrolled in a Government school or in a school recognized by the Government or a Central/State Board of Secondary Education
Benefits The selected students will receive the following benefits-
- Scholarship up to INR 350 per month
- Books and Ad Hoc grant up to INR 1,000 per annum
- Additional allowance for students with disabilities
Documents - A passport size photograph
- Scheduled Tribe certificate duly signed by an authorised Revenue Officer
- Income declaration, a certificate from the parents/guardians

Selection Criteria
All the eligible ST candidates will be given scholarship subject to the application of means test prescribed in the regulations.
Important documents
Terms and Conditions
- The scholarship will be given for only one year. A student will not receive a scholarship for repeating a class.
- In an academic year, the scholarship will be payable for 10 months.
- A student getting a scholarship in Class 9 will be able to renew it for Class 10 subject to good conduct and regularity in attendance.
- The income certificate will be taken only once which will be at the time of admission to the course.
- The Government of India at its own discretion can change the provisions of this scheme any time.
